Atlas Shrugged, a 1957 novel by Ayn Rand (1905 – 1982), was this controversial authors last, and longest work of fiction, though she went on to publish many other works of nonfiction rooted in her Objectivist philosophy. Eventually, a mysterious man named John Galt persuades the most innovative and oppressed individualists to simply go “on strike.” This puts society in the hands of the Altruists, who know nothing of how to produce wealth, only how to redistribute it and that is why society collapses. Ayn Rand is best known as the author of the perennially bestselling novels The Fountainhead and Atlas Shrugged.
